VOLUNTEERS are being sought to help spruce up the home of a blossoming community project.
The Allotment Soup Project field in Walney is in need of some tender loving care over the summer months, and two events are being held to get the work done.
A work-day for weeds will take place on Friday July 28 from 10am until 2pm, with volunteers asked to help clear communal growing areas, paths and plots. The next day, at the same time, a second work-day will involve a trackway tidy and plant survey of the site, which is run by Art Gene.
